DB数据无缝迁移至MySQL指南
db数据 迁移到 mysql

首页 2025-07-28 01:39:26



数据库迁移之路:从DB到MySQL的全面解析 在数字化时代,数据库作为企业信息系统的核心组成部分,承载着企业运营过程中产生的海量数据

    随着技术的发展和业务需求的变化,数据库迁移成为了企业不得不面对的重要课题

    本文将重点探讨从其他数据库(简称DB)迁移到MySQL的过程,分析迁移的必要性、挑战,并提供一套行之有效的迁移方案

     一、迁移的必要性 为什么越来越多的企业选择将数据库从其他系统迁移到MySQL呢?这背后有多重驱动力

     1.成本考量:MySQL作为一款开源的关系型数据库管理系统,其使用成本相对较低,对于中小型企业而言,可以有效降低IT支出

     2.性能与稳定性:MySQL经过多年的发展,已经证明了其在处理大量数据时的优异性能和稳定性

    它能够轻松应对高并发访问,满足企业日益增长的数据处理需求

     3.易用性与兼容性:MySQL拥有简洁的语法和强大的功能,易于学习和使用

    同时,它广泛支持各种操作系统和开发语言,为企业的技术选型提供了极大的灵活性

     4.社区支持:MySQL背后有一个庞大的开源社区,这意味着企业可以快速获取到最新的技术资源、安全更新以及问题解决方案

     二、迁移的挑战 尽管MySQL具有诸多优势,但从其他数据库迁移到MySQL并非一帆风顺,企业需面临以下挑战: 1.数据结构与类型的差异:不同的数据库系统在数据结构和数据类型上可能存在差异,这要求迁移团队在迁移前进行详细的规划和设计,确保数据的完整性和准确性

     2.存储过程与函数的转换:如果原数据库中使用了大量的存储过程和函数,迁移过程中可能需要对这些代码进行重写或转换,以适应MySQL的语法和特性

     3.性能调优:迁移后,数据库的性能可能会发生变化

    因此,需要对MySQL进行性能调优,以确保其能够满足业务的实际需求

     4.安全性考虑:在迁移过程中,数据的安全性至关重要

    必须采取措施防止数据泄露、损坏或丢失

     三、迁移方案 针对上述挑战,我们提出以下迁移方案: 1.预迁移评估:在迁移开始之前,对原数据库进行全面的评估,包括数据量、数据结构、存储过程、函数以及性能等方面

    这有助于制定详细的迁移计划和时间表

     2.数据迁移准备:根据评估结果,确定数据迁移的策略和方法

    这可能包括使用专业的数据迁移工具、编写自定义的迁移脚本或者结合两者进行

    同时,确保备份原数据库的所有数据,以防万一

     3.环境搭建与测试:在迁移之前,搭建与生产环境相似的测试环境,并进行全面的测试

    这包括功能测试、性能测试以及安全测试等,以确保迁移后的MySQL数据库能够正常工作并满足业务需求

     4.正式迁移:在测试无误后,开始进行正式的数据迁移

    这个过程需要密切关注迁移的进度和可能出现的问题,确保数据能够准确无误地迁移到MySQL中

     5.后迁移验证与优化:迁移完成后,对MySQL数据库进行验证,确保所有数据和功能都已正确迁移

    同时,根据实际的业务需求和性能表现,对MySQL进行必要的优化和调整

     四、总结 从其他数据库迁移到MySQL是一个复杂而细致的过程,需要企业投入足够的人力和物力资源

    然而,通过合理的规划和执行有效的迁移方案,企业可以成功地将数据库迁移到MySQL,并享受到MySQL带来的诸多优势

    在这个数据驱动的时代,掌握数据库迁移的技能和经验,将为企业的发展提供有力的支撑

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道